Customer Service Manager (CSM) employees have rated Oracle with 3.7 out of 5 stars, based on 71 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most Customer Service Manager (CSM) professionals have a good working experience there. Oracle is rated in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) by Customer Service Manager (CSM) professionals compared to other employers within the Informationstechnologie industry (3.9 stars).

Pros

Flexible remote work. Being a new department, everyone is learning from manager lines onwards. Very friendly and supportive environment. Good exposure to medium and large companies.

Cons

Trainings and materials are really outdated. Pretty difficult to get your hands on the actual documentation needed to move forward. Support department needs a whole reshuffling - so too many technical chasing on the CSMs plate.
